Georgia reveals volume of exported apples

Some 5,045 tons of apples worth $2.2 million were exported from Georgia. from August 1 to November 23, 2020, Trend reports via the Ministry of Environment Protection and Agriculture.

The export volume of apples for this period is 12 times higher than the export volume for the same period of 2019, and the export value increased by $1.9 million.

The export of Georgian apples this year was mainly carried out to the Russian Federation (46,884 tons).

In addition to the Russian Federation, exports were also carried out to Kazakhstan, Singapore, and Hong Kong.

This year, Georgian farmers have earned over 9 million lari ($2.7 million) from the sale of non-standard apples.
